The premise was simple: Houston residents adopt a local storm drain through the Adopt-A-Drain website, give the drain a nickname, and commit to cleaning debris such as leaves and trash from the drain four times a year.
Other users have also exploited the nickname field for personal advertising – one user shared their Twitch channel handle in a ploy for followers, while another shared their Cash-App username to solicit money. Houston’s Adopt-A-Drain program demonstrates how problems can arise when local governments adopt community-built projects without ensuring the proper safeguards have been put into place to monitor them. Projects like Adopt-A-Drain are intended to encourage community engagement, but can quickly drift away from the original purpose when they are abused.
